eSIM: More Than Just Connectivity… A Roadmap to Dynamic Security and Flexible Control for Connected Devices
Topics that will be covered include:
  • Introduction to the eSIM’s ‘power of three’ proposition: flexible control, authenticated connectivity, and dynamic security.
  • Current thinking on IoT security concerns and requirements: what industry influencers / governments are saying and doing.
  • eSIM momentum: real-life references / how eSIM deployments are reshaping industries.
  • How the eSIM addresses technical deployment and security challenges, with a focus on key deployments, including connected cars, smart metering and wearables.

Smart Home: Simply Exciting?
The world moved from a 3 billion acquisition of Nest to many analysts showing an almost flat line for smarthome while the chaos in wireless standards is already lasting since 15 years. On the other hand, products like Hive are successful and eQ-3 has shipped >27 million wireless devices. What ist he secret to success – or doom?
